网络协议分析工具在现代网络管理中扮演着至关重要的角色。Wireshark作为一款开源的网络封包分析软件,广泛应用于网络故障排除、性能监控和安全分析。它能够实时捕捉和分析网络流量,帮助用户深入了解数据在网络中的流动情况。通过使用Wireshark,网络管理员和安全专家可以识别潜在的安全威胁,优化网络性能,并确保各种应用的正常运行。本文将详细介绍Wireshark的安装、配置及其核心功能,帮助用户有效地捕捉和分析网络数据。

Wireshark的安装过程相对简单。用户可以访问其官方网站,选择适用于自己操作系统的版本进行下载。安装完成后,启动Wireshark,用户需要授予其适当的权限,以便捕获网络数据流。在Windows系统中,通常需要使用管理员权限运行;而在Linux系统中,则需要通过sudo命令来激活基本功能。
接下来,用户需要配置Wireshark以捕捉特定的网络数据。选择捕获菜单下的选项,可以看到不同的网络接口。在这里,用户可以选择想要监控的网络连接,例如无线网络或有线局域网。在确定接口后,点击开始按钮,Wireshark便会开始捕获经过该接口的所有数据包。
捕获到的数据包将显示在Wireshark的主界面上,用户可以实时查看。每个数据包都包含多种信息,包括源IP地址、目标IP地址、协议类型和具体的数据内容等。通过点击每个数据包,用户可以展开详细信息,分析出错的原因或者识别可疑的活动。例如,通过分析TCP和UDP协议的数据包,用户能了解特定服务的运行状况,从而进行有针对性的优化。
Wireshark在数据分析方面还有很强的过滤功能。用户可以使用过滤表达式来只显示特定类型的数据包,例如HTTP流量、ICMP请求或特定IP地址之间的通信。运用过滤器可以极大地提高分析效率,帮助用户快速定位问题所在。
Wireshark支持数据包的保存和导出。用户可以将捕获的数据包保存为特定格式,以便于后续分析或与其他团队成员共享。通过将捕获的数据导出为CSV或JSON格式,用户还可以使用其他工具进行更加深入的数据分析。
Wireshark是一款功能强大且易于使用的网络协议分析工具。它不仅能帮助用户捕捉和分析网络数据,检测安全问题,还能在网络优化中发挥重要作用。无论是网络管理人员、开发人员还是安全专家,通过掌握Wireshark的使用技巧,都能在工作中事半功倍,提升整体的网络运维效率。
